Summary
Join Cartwheel's mission to revolutionize student mental health by providing psychiatric medication management for school-age children and adolescents. As a 100% remote, independent contractor Psychiatrist, you will collaborate with school staff, students, and families to enhance mental health support systems within partner school districts. Your responsibilities include medication management, case discussions with the care team, supporting transitions to community providers, building relationships with school stakeholders, leading mental health workshops, and partnering with school leadership. This role requires an MD or DO license in GA, experience with children and adolescents, strong technological skills, and excellent communication abilities. Competitive compensation includes an hourly rate plus a quarterly mission bonus, administrative support, and access to an AI-enabled medical scribe. Cartwheel offers a team-based care environment and is committed to diversity and inclusion.
